talking to yourself is ok as long as you are not the only person you talk to during the week and you do it in privacy.

I talk to myself when going through my routine of getting ready to go out, it is the only way i remember everything i need...boots, boot warmers, jumper, waterproof, gloves, hand warmers, phone, meds, pads, spare pants,purse,blankey, scooter charger, etc!

I also talk to myself when processing things that have upset me...like having a conversation i should have had but couldn't at the time. it helps me to be prepared for the next encounter with the person who upset me and makes me feel better. the only problem with this is that i usually find myself having this conversation as i am scootering home and find i get some strange looks though this is not so bad lately as most people here use hands free phones so it looks like i am talking on a phone!

talking to yourself can be a sign of loneliness, especially if you are housebound and have very few or no visitors. It can also be a sign of some mental disorders, e.g people who hear voices often vocalise replies to the voices, but not everyone with a mental disorder talks to themself.
